Aplicação desenvolvida para controlar a receita de um Microprodutor rural.
- React
- Node.js
- npm
- Neon DataBase
Essas instruções permitirão que você obtenha uma cópia do projeto em operação na sua máquina local para fins de desenvolvimento e teste.
Para o banco de dados, em src/db/config/example_Config.json deve ser preenchido com os dados de seu banco de dados criado.
- 1° - Defina suas variaveis de ambiente conforme os exemple.env
- 2° - Clone o repositório em sua máquina
- 3° - Rode o comando "npm install"
- 4° - Para iniciar o servidor, rode o comando "nodemon ./server.js " dentro do caminho ~/backend/src
- 5° - Para iniciar a aplicação WEB, rode o comando "npm start" a partir do caminho ~/frontEnd/src
- 6° - Para iniciar o servidor email, rode o comando "npx maildev" a partir do caminho ~/backend/src
Mencione as ferramentas que você usou para criar seu projeto
- React - Framework utilizado para o frontEnd
- Express - O framework utilizado para construção do backEnd
- NeonDatabase - Banco de dados utilizado
- Sequelize - ORM utilizada para facilitar queries no banco de dados
- Swagger - Plataforma para documentar os endpoints criados da api
- MailDev - Servidor de email
Nós usamos Git para controle de versão. Para as versões disponíveis, observe as tags neste repositório.
Mencione todos aqueles que ajudaram a levantar o projeto desde o seu início
- Matheus Henrique Lourenço Bernardo - Trabalho Inicial/LT/Estrutura/Backend/FrontEnd - Matheus Bernardo
- Iza Lopes - Responsável pelo BackEnd/Design - Iza lopes
- Guilherme cotta - Responsável pelo BackEnd - Guilherme Cotta
- João Ryan - Responsável pelo FrontEnd - João Ryan
- Juliely Lima - Responsável pelo FrontEnd - Juliely Lima
- Marcio Taier - Responsável pelo FrontEnd/BackEnd - Marcio Taier
Você também pode ver a lista de todos os colaboradores que participaram deste projeto.